Proconsular Cistophori. M. Tullius Cicero as proconsul in Cilicia. Theopropos son Apollonios, magistrate. AR Cistophorus. Apameia, 51/50 BC. Serpent emerging from cista mystica; all within wreath / M·CICERO·[M.F] - PROCOS. Two serpents entwined by bow case. Stumpf 89; Metcalf 470-471

Attribution is incorrect. This coin was not issued by Ap. Claudius Pulcher but by M. Tullius Cicero during his tenure as proconsul in Cilicia 51-50 BC. This is the third known example of the type and currently the only coin issued by Cicero in private hands.
